Pour down from above, you heavens, and let the skies rain down righteousness! Let the earth open wide and produce salvation, and let righteousness spring up alongside it. I, the LORD, have made this happen."
Drop down, ye heavens, from above, and let the skies pour down righteousness: let the earth open, and let them bring forth salvation, and let righteousness spring up together; I the LORD have created it.
Verse Analysis
Plain-English insight for readers
In Isaiah 45:8, the prophet calls for the heavens to pour down righteousness and for the earth to open up and produce salvation. This imagery suggests a divine intervention where God’s righteousness and salvation are made manifest in the world. The verse emphasizes that these blessings are not just natural occurrences but are orchestrated by God Himself. The phrase 'I, the LORD, have made this happen' underscores God's sovereignty and creative power. It reflects a hope for a time when righteousness will flourish and salvation will be evident, highlighting the relationship between heaven and earth in God's plan for humanity. This passage encourages believers to look for God's active role in bringing about justice and salvation, reminding them that these gifts are gifts from God, not human achievements. It serves as a reminder of the transformative power of God’s righteousness in the world, calling for a response of faith and trust in His promises.

What does Isaiah 45:8 mean?
Isaiah 45:8 expresses a call for divine intervention where the heavens and earth collaborate to bring forth righteousness and salvation. It emphasizes that these blessings are orchestrated by God, highlighting His sovereignty and creative power.
What is the significance of righteousness in Isaiah 45:8?
In Isaiah 45:8, righteousness symbolizes God's moral order and justice that He desires to see in the world. The verse portrays righteousness as a gift from God, meant to flourish and transform lives.
How does Isaiah 45:8 relate to salvation?
Isaiah 45:8 connects righteousness with salvation, suggesting that true salvation comes from God's intervention and is accompanied by His righteousness. It indicates that both are essential aspects of God's plan for humanity.
What does 'I, the LORD, have made this happen' mean in Isaiah 45:8?
The phrase 'I, the LORD, have made this happen' in Isaiah 45:8 underscores God's active role in bringing about righteousness and salvation. It affirms His authority and creative power in fulfilling His promises.
